2000 SESSION
SB 348 Exclusion of victims in juvenile proceedings.
Introduced by: William C. Mims |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les | history
SUMMARY AS PASSED:
Exclusion of victims. Provides that a victim in a juvenile or adult proceeding may not be excluded from the courtroom unless the court determines that the presence of the victim would impair the conduct of a fair trial.
S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:
Exclusion of victims. Provides that a victim in a juvenile proceeding may not be excluded from the courtroom unless the court determines that the presence of the victim would substantially impair the conduct of a fair trial.
